Gaustad, Julius A.
2 Oct 1902-6 Jun 1965
CCC worker, an electrician, who installed cross canyon telephone line. Stated that he had a "helper" but was not satisfied with the helper's work and so did most of it himself. Also found and reported to the Park Service a large archeological site off the east rim drive and near the phone line.

Johnson, Fred
25 Oct 1898-20 Feb 1929
Lost in Colorado River boat accident. See Sturdevant. Ranger's Johnson's body was not recovered. The Park Service decided that they should attempt such a recovery for the comfort of the widow. They dynamited the rapid, but to no avail. Note: The Park Service does not now use explosives on rapids.

McKee, Dr. Edwin Dinwiddie
24 Sep 1907-23 Jul 1984
Second ranger naturalist at Grand Canyon. Founded Grand Canyon Natural History Association later Grand Canyon Association. Identified Grand Canyon Pink Rattler as species unknown to science. This gravestone is Tapeats Sandstone, and was acquired with great stealth and cunning from Pumpkin Spring and carried out by helicopter by a local geologist while he was doing geological research on the River.

*United Airlines Accident Memorial
On June 30, 1956, at 11:30 a.m., TWA Flight 2 (Constellation) with 70 persons aboard, collided with United Airlines Flight 718 (DC-7), with 58 persons aboard, over the Grand Canyon. Points of impact were on Temple and Chuar Buttes near the confluence of the Little Colorado and Colorado Rivers. Both flights were at approximately 20,000 feet and originated from Los Angeles. There were no survivors; 128 died. At the time, this was the worst disaster in commercial aviation history. The bodies of 29 of the 58 United Airline accident victims were identified and returned to their homes for burial. The unidentified are represented by four coffins buried below this memorial. Names of 2 relatives of the 29 unidentified dead were added to the memorial, bringing the total of names engraved on the monument to 31. Another monument was erected for the TWA crash victims at Citizens Cemetery in Flagstaff, Arizona. The planes were both traveling east at approximately 300 miles per hour on a gradually converging course at the same elevation. Investigators determined that the left wing tip of the United Airlines flight apparently struck the rear part of the TWA flight. The TWA plane apparently changed course to go above and south of the cloud formation. The last message from either plane was from the United DC-7 at 11:30 a.m., "Salt Lake, United 718--ah--we're going in." *Source: GC Museum Cemetery File.
